Published in The Tennessean on August 22-23, 2011Murphy Elizabeth Fingar CHARLESTON - Entered into eternal rest on the morning of August 19, 2011, Murphy Elizabeth Fingar, widow of Julian Russell Fingar. Resident of Charleston, South Carolina; formerly of Nashville, Tennessee. Funeral and burial services at a later date. Local arrangements by J. HENRY STUHR, INC., WEST ASHLEY CHAPEL.

Mrs. Fingar was born on December 10, 1911, in Nashville, Tennessee, daughter of the late Elijah Wilbur and Esmer Petty Vaden. She was a member of Woodbine Cumberland Presbyterian Church in Nashville and was a homemaker.

She is survived by a son, Walter Fingar and wife Mildred of Charleston, and six grandchildren, Libbye Bennett and Linda Miller both of Charleston, Walter Fingar of Hilton Head, SC, Russell Fingar of Charleston, Rachel Ringer of Savannah, GA, and Amy Graves of Charleston.
